WebJul 1, 2024 · Make sure the root flare, the tapered area at the base of the trunk, is placed above ground. Refill the hole but don’t add anything such as peat moss to the soil. Though that used to be the recommendation, trees actually do better when their roots learn to grow in the native soil.
